Traducción & Definición
some sort of (chicken dish): una especie de, un tipo de (plato de pollo)
He has some sort of cell phone that also acts as a toaster. Él tiene una especie de teléfono que también tuesta el pan.
(I'm) sort of (hungry): (Estoy) hambriento
